The Good

• Prime Location: The property is located in a desirable Tampa area, with easy access to Tampa International Airport, South Tampa, shopping, and dining. This makes it convenient for residents who value proximity to amenities and transportation. • Water Views: The property offers stunning water views from the living room, dining room, and two back bedrooms, enhancing its appeal and potentially increasing its value. Waterfront properties in Tampa typically command a premium of 10-20% compared to similar properties without water views. • Modern Features: The property features granite countertops, stainless steel appliances, and updated bathrooms, providing a modern and move-in-ready feel. These upgrades can attract buyers who are looking for a home that requires minimal renovations. • Low HOA Fees and No CDD: The property has low HOA fees and no CDD fees, which can save homeowners money on monthly expenses. CDD fees in Tampa can range from $1,000 to $3,000 per year, so the absence of these fees is a significant advantage.

The Bad

• High Flood Risk: The property has an "EXTREME" flood risk score of 9/10 and is located in FEMA flood zone AE, indicating a high probability of flooding. This will result in significantly higher insurance costs. Average flood insurance premiums in Tampa can range from $800 to $3,000 per year, depending on the level of coverage. • High Wind Risk: The property has an "EXTREME" wind risk score of 10/10, which is a major concern in Tampa due to hurricanes. This will also increase insurance premiums. Homes built before 2002 may not meet current wind mitigation standards, potentially increasing vulnerability to damage. • Age of the Property: Built in 1985, the property is over 35 years old. Older homes often require more maintenance and repairs compared to newer construction. Potential buyers should factor in costs for potential upgrades to electrical, plumbing, and HVAC systems. • Previous Price Reductions: The property has undergone multiple price reductions since June 2024, suggesting that it may be overpriced relative to the market. The initial listing price of $439,900 has been reduced to $395,000, a decrease of approximately 10.2%. This could indicate that the seller is struggling to find a buyer at the current price point.

The Ugly

• Potential for High Insurance Costs: Due to the extreme flood and wind risks, insurance costs for the property are likely to be significantly higher than average. This could impact affordability, especially for buyers on a tight budget. It is critical to get an accurate insurance quote before making an offer. • Possible Hidden Maintenance Costs: Given the age of the property, there is a higher likelihood of encountering unexpected maintenance issues, such as roof repairs, plumbing problems, or electrical upgrades. A thorough inspection is essential to identify any potential problems. • Risk of Water Damage: The property's location in a high-risk flood zone increases the likelihood of water damage from flooding events. This can lead to costly repairs, mold issues, and health concerns. Mitigation measures, such as elevating the property or installing flood barriers, may be necessary but can be expensive. • Heat Risk: The Heat Risk is Extreme (10/10), with 7 hot days a year, with the 98th percentile temp at 106°F
